Nawaz approves billions for Rawalpindi Cantt

Author: Online

RAWALPINDI: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if has approved billion of rupees development package for the areas of Rawalpindi Cantonment.

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z MNA from NA-54 Malik Abrar Ahmed called on the prime minister to get his nod to launch a host of development projects in his jurisdiction, sources said.

According to the sources, the prime minister approved a 300-bed modern hospital on 10 kanal on IGP Road, the Cantonment Waste Management Authority at a cost of Rs 200 million, Rs400 million development schemes in Chaklala Cantt areas, two filtration plants costing Rs 200 million, four high schools for girls and boys and one postgraduate college and a 1000-kanal graveyard in Dhamial Rakh.
